What MXM is used by the iMac!?
I would like to upgrade my iMac to one of the newer graphic cards on the market - This being something the standard 6750M and 6770M 512mb.

These both use a MXM-A port.

But the 27" can be bought with both 6770M and 6970M - The 6970 uses a MXM-B port.


Is its just:
21.5" = MXM-A

27 " = MXM-B
